Releasing the Weight of the Mind, Restoring Clarity’s Graceful Flow

Chronic headaches, TMJ dysfunction, tech-neck, and forward head posture are increasingly common conditions among clients. This full-day hands-on course equips massage therapists with specialized, therapeutic techniques for addressing muscular tension and fascial restrictions in the head, neck, jaw, and cervical spine. Drawing from myofascial release, neuromuscular therapy, cranial soft tissue work, and intraoral protocols (externally applied), students will gain confidence working with this delicate and often neglected region of the body. Special focus is placed on client communication, gentle touch, and structural awareness, empowering practitioners to work effectively and safely with issues like bruxism, headaches, whiplash, and postural strain.

Learning Objectives & Outcomes

By the end of this course, participants will be able to:

  • Describe the anatomical structures and functional relationships of the head, neck, jaw, and cervical spine
  • Identify common muscular and fascial dysfunctions associated with headaches, TMJ pain, and neck restriction
  • Perform therapeutic manual therapy techniques for soft tissue release of the jaw, suboccipital region, and anterior/posterior cervical structures
  • Apply fascial and cranial decompression techniques to support relaxation and alignment
  • Integrate client-centered communication and draping for sensitive areas
  • Design short treatment sequences for clinical and spa settings
